Position Title: Senior Asset Development Manager

Location: Los Angeles Unified School District (Candidates must be able and willing to commute to Los Angeles, CA)

Due Date: 05/28/25

Duties:

  • Establishes the structures, formulae, and assumptions necessary to plan for multibillion school construction
  • Manages and oversees planning and master planning architects and in-house staff Works with Board staff to translate policy direction into actionable staff instructions
  • Coordinates with the Office of Environmental, Health and Safety (OEHS) for California Environmental Quality Act (CEQA) and other agency environmental clearances
  • Protects the long- term asset values and uses of district real estate and other assets
  • Formulates strategies that increase the flexible use of district assets
  • Regulates appropriate resources and energy toward high priority, high risk, high benefit projects for the Facilities Services Division of the Los Angeles Unified School District


Minimum Requirements:

Required Experience

  • Twenty (20) years full-time paid professional experience in planning and development of public agencies, educational or institutional facilities
  • Five years’ experience overseeing complex survey activities of educational properties for physical attributes and current and possible future facilities uses
  • Five years overseeing development of recommendations for allocation of anticipated funds that will enable future projects to be developed and undertaken
  • Five years overseeing recommendations for future projects priority lists and phasing that supports educational master plans/educational programming


Preferred Experience

  • Experience utilizing Building Information Modeling (BIM)
  • Experience with LEED and/or Collaborative for High Performance Schools (CHPS) projects
  • Experience with the Division of the State Architect (DSA) construction/design processes
  • Experience with construction management


Required Education

  • Graduation from a recognized college or university with a bachelor’s degree in engineering, architecture, or construction management
  • Additional courses in business administration, public relations, accounting, school finance, personnel management, educational facilities planning, and communication are preferred


Preferred Licenses and Certificates

  • A valid Certificate of Registration as an Architect by the California State Architectural Board or Professional Engineer by the State Board for Professional Engineers and Land Surveyors
  • A valid Construction Manager (CCM) credential by the Construction Manager Certification Institute (CMCI) LEED Professional Accreditation


Offered rate of compensation will be based on a variety of non-discriminatory factors, including education, qualifications, experience, and geographic location. The salary range for this position is $185,000 - $197,000.
